About Poundal
The poundal (pdl) is the force unit of the foot-pound-second absolute system - the force to accelerate 1 pound at 1 ft/s² - approximately 0.1383 N. Introduced in 1877 by Thomson and Tait as the FPS analogue of the CGS dyne (1 dyn = 1 g·cm/s²; 1 pdl = 1 lb·ft/s²). The poundal is distinct from pound-force: since standard gravity = 32.174 ft/s², 1 lbf = 32.174 pdl. It survives in older British engineering texts and early 20th-century thermodynamics literature, but is otherwise obsolete. 1 pdl = 0.138254954376 N = 1/32.174 lbf.
About Millinewtons
A millinewton (mN) is 10⁻³ N - the force scale of lightweight structures and precision connectors. A mosquito weighs ~1-3 mN; a grain of rice ~29 mN; a paper clip ~40 mN. USB connector insertion forces are specified at 40-80 mN; keyboard switch actuation (ISO 9241) 40-80 mN. Piezoelectric hard drive head positioning actuators deliver 10-100 mN. Spider dragline silk (4 µm diameter) breaks at 40-60 mN - among the highest specific strengths in nature. Flexible electronics peel-force and thin-film adhesion tests also operate in the mN range. 1 mN = 10⁻³ N.
